Tinto's "Model of Institutional Departure" states that, to persist, students need integration into formal (academic performance) and informal (faculty/staff interactions) academic systems and formal (extracurricular activities) and informal (peer-group interactions) social systems.

For this study, persistence is defined as the ability of a student to remain in full- or part-time status at a higher education institution (Tinto, 2012).
Persistence rate is measured by the percentage of students who return to college at any institution for their second year, while retention rate represents the percentage of students who return to the same institution.

College questionnaires are tools for coaches to gauge interest in a wide range of student-athletes. They help coaches build a database of recruits based on answers to relevant questions. They are an early sign that you are on the coach's radar, and your skills are comparable to other recruits.
